The cheapest times to fly from DFW to JFK are
- January 1st to March 4th
- March 19th to April 15th
- August 13th to November 18th (except the weeks of August 27th and October 1st)
based on data collected exclusively by Champion Traveler across tens of millions of flights. Among all the dates above, the very cheapest time to fly from DFW to JFK is late January and early February. Prices can be as high as $475 for Sunday flights during mid to late November, or as low as $230 for Tuesday flights around late January and early February.
When to Fly to New York
Flying from Dallas/Fort Worth, TX (DFW) to New York, NY (JFK) will usually cost between $245 to $361 per person if booking more than four weeks in advance. On average the very cheapest time to fly is late January and early February with an average ticket price of $244. Due to high demand the most expensive time to fly is mid to late November, with an average price of $374. Planning your trip to low-cost times can easily save you $130 on economy flights and even more on first-class flights. Generally, any price below $286 can be considered a good price for a round-trip DFW to JFK flight.

Flight Prices by Day of the Week
Tuesday is usually the cheapest day to fly to JFK, and Wednesday the cheapest day to fly back into DFW. Sundays are the most expensive days to fly out or take a return trip. Selecting flights on the least expensive days could save you up to $38 (12%) on this flight.
Departing prices are for round-trip flights returning on the day of departure. For example, a flight departing on Tuesday and returning a week later will cost an average of $271. Nonstop Flights and Layovers
Travelers looking to fly from DFW to JFK can generally find a 0-layover flight. Because there is a direct flight option the real-world direct flight time of 3 hour 29 minutes may be realistic.

Which airlines fly this route?
You can find 7 major airlines flying this route most often: Alaska, American, China Eastern, Delta, JetBlue, Qantas, United, and potentially more during busy seasons.
How far away is it from John F. Kennedy International Airport to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port?
The distance between the two airports is roughly 1388 miles or 2234 kilometers.
How long does it take to fly from DFW to JFK?
The real-world flight time for a nonstop DFW to JFK flight is about 3 hour 29 minutes.
How many flights go between Dallas/Fort Worth, TX and New York, NY?
It depends on the day of the week and the date, but a typical day might have around 69 available flights from DFW to JFK.

Late and Early Flight Data
Flights from DFW to JFK tend to depart later than the average flight. According to our recently updated data, 34% of flights departed 5 or more minutes late, and 10% of flights left 5 or more minutes early. On average you can expect to leave JFK heading for DFW about 25 minutes late. This does significantly impact arrival time, as the average landing time in New York, NY is about 23 minutes late.
